Zanussi
Handle Latch / Upright Lock Failure
Unit will not stand upright or latch into storage position
Advertisements
Possible Causes
Broken upright lock lever, Worn latch teeth, Misaligned handle pivot, Foreign object in latch mechanism
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ety: Unplug the cleaner before working on the handle.
- Inspect latch area: Examine the Zanussi handle base where it locks into upright. Look for broken plastic parts or obstructions.
- Clean mechanism: Remove any debris or fibres caught in the latch.
- Replace latch parts: If the lock lever or teeth are worn or broken, replace the upright lock assembly or handle base as a unit.
- Check alignment: Ensure the handle pivot screws are tight and the handle is not twisted.
